  • *Pattern of change over 1 year period, classified using ‘Minimally important clinical difference (MCID)’ cut-offs for continuous variables, and change in response category for ordinal variables. Improvement: Increase ≥MCID or improvement by ≥1 category; No change: Remaining within +/-MCID of baseline reading, or remaining in same category; Deterioration: Reduction ≥MCID or deterioration by ≥1 category.

  • †No existing MCID agreed in literature: cut-off calculated by 0.5 x SD of baseline data.

  • ‡MCID derived from COPD literature.42

  • BMI, body mass index; CXR, chest radiography; SGRQ, St George’s Respiratory Questionnaire.
